SOS Server 4.x won't start - Illegal Characters in Path

A collection of information about SourceOffSite, including solutions to common problems.

Moderator: SourceGear

Post Reply
lbauer
Posts: 9736
Joined: Tue Dec 16, 2003 1:25 pm
Location: SourceGear

SOS Server 4.x won't start - Illegal Characters in Path

Post by lbauer » Thu Sep 30, 2004 11:30 am

This article applies to SOS versions 4.1 and earlier. This bug was fixed in SOS 4.1.2.

A bug in the SOS 4.1 installer causes quotation marks to be added to the path to SOSSvrSvs in the registry during SOS Server installation. This prevents the SOS Server Service from starting.

The following error is logged in the Event Viewer:

Service cannot be started. System.ArgumentException: Illegal characters in path.

To fix:

Open Regedit and find this key:

HKEY_LOCAL_MACHINE\SYSTEM\ControlSet001\Services\SosSvrSvc.net

If there are quotes around

C:\Program Files\SourceOffSite Server4\SosService.exe,

delete them and the service should now start.

This does not affect machines if the SOS Server was installed before the new service packs were installed.
Linda Bauer
SourceGear
Technical Support Manager

Post Reply